Well... off of current episodes without manga spoilers, there is no way to be able to determine. Even with manga spoilers, it's still impossible to say.

The reason being:

1) Neferpitou, Menthuthuyoupi and Shaiapouf have not even shown their Nen abilities or fighting capabilities yet. We know Pitou defeated Kaito and easily took an arm, but we didn't see the fight and to date have just been given slight hints towards what her ability is. Pouf has only shown his ability to fly and Youpi has only shown an ability to grow wings. With manga spoilers, we know this groups full capabilities in both Nen application and combat abilities. However...

2) Hisoka, Illumi and Kuroro have all never been shown in a serious fight. We know Kuroro is skilled enough to fight the two top assassins at the same time while only fighting to steal their abilities, but that's just it, he wasn't fighting to kill them. Had he engaged Zeno and Silva in a fight to the death, who knows what the outcome would've been. Hisoka has never once been in a serious fight in any of his appearances in the series. So it is hard to gauge where he is at. I know ValeBreck said it is safe to assume he is at the same level as Kaito, but that is just to much of an unreliable estimation. For all we know, Hisoka could be weaker than Kaito and just have been a whole lot of talk (which I doubt). He very well could be the same level as Kaito/ However, there is the distinct possibility that Hisoka is the most gifted Nen users in the world and one of the strongest as well. He could very well have been stronger than the Royal Guards. At this point, we honestly just can't safely assume since Togashi hasn't really showed us everything there is with Hisoka. That brings us to Illumi, who at the current point in the series has not shown us much of anything. The only thing we know is that he is a capable assassin that both Hisoka and Kuroro greatly respect and that he uses needles in combat. Other than that, we just have no clue with this guy.

I think there are just too many variables to consider when it comes to this kind of "what-if" battle to determine at the moment. At least in my opinion, if you feel that gauging Hisoka and Illumi based on Kaito is a sure fire method, then you have your answer. I just don't like to take assumptions into it right now based on a bunch of questions still out there about a good portion of these characters. if all of them are first meet and doesnt know about each other ability, then of course the royal guards. no doubt about it.

in official databook, there are data about character's aura, skill, stamina , knowledge, ingenuity, and mind.

and here are their stats : (aura/skill/sta/know/ingen/mind)

1. pitou : 5/5/5/4/5/4 total = 28
2. pouf : 5/5/5/5/5/3 total = 28
3. youpi : 5/5/5/4/3/5 total = 27
4. chrollo : 4/4/4/4/4/5 total = 25
5. hisoka : 4/4/4/4/5/3 = total = 24
6. illumi : unknown

3 pts different means they are on the different level.

even it doesnt include physical strength & speed.

in those departments, only chrollo that is in the same level with one of the royal guard (youpi). but not the rest. if we include their physical strength, then no way chrollo can be compared to youpi.
